Abstract
Compounds of formula (I):
and pharmacologically acceptable salts and pro-drugs thereof, wherein the variables are as defined in the specification, are potassium ion channel modulators, making them particularly useful in treating and preventing conditions such as pain, lower urinary tract disorders and the like.
